Transaction af3a07bdfd638a8a382c582063f17151ebca024f04c74b1093e2143fe9475c83
2 Input
2 Outputs
- af3a07bdfd638a8a382c582063f17151ebca024f04c74b1093e2143fe9475c83:0
- af3a07bdfd638a8a382c582063f17151ebca024f04c74b1093e2143fe9475c83:1
value 15163
address 1KpPWFzhAw9qqJvFwQ4FZo9tedGiGNYXbf
value 142687
address 33CThKYRf7Seer18C6VajEJwLTnKQ9tn8K